Match Report | 2nd April 2008 » Sheffield Scimitars 3-2 Peterborough Phantoms
Face Off: 7.15pm, Saturday 29th March 2008
29.3.08
The Scimitars moved into the 2nd play-off weekend having won their first two opening games. This weekend saw a home and away double-header against Peterborough for the 12th and 13th time this season, and with Peterborough having the edge in head-to-head results.
The Scimitars were still without the GB 18's, who had just won the silver medal in Estonia, and were still playing with three imports only for yet another weekend. Peterborough needed a minimum of 2 points to keep their hopes alive for making it to Coventry and came out fast from the face-off, as did the Scimitars.
The Scimitars were able to pick up an early PP goal at 2.15 as Ron Shudra, on the back post, found the back of the net off an accurate cross from Stephen Wallace. Sheffield was the more dominant team in the first period though Paul Jones made a couple of exceptional saves to keep Peterborough off the scoreboard. Robert Dowd had a great solo effort in keeping the puck in the zone even from flat on the ice. Another fast, end-to-end game with the Scimitars passing the puck well and controlling possession even when playing 4-on-4. Buckman picked up a 2+10 for checking Lloyd Gibson to the head but no further scoring was added and the period ended 1-0.
Both netminders called into action early in the 2nd, Wall making a great double save and Jones stopping a shot with his face-mask. Gough finally got the Phantoms on the board with a SH goal at 25.48 after a clear breakaway alone on goal with Miller chasing in behind. Another breakaway shot on goal hit the top bar in the corner at 27.53 but bounced down in front of the goal line and was covered. The Phantoms were convinced they had scored but no goal given resulting in the temperature being raised on and off ice. The Scimitars scored again at 32.27, a PP goal by Moberg as the Phantoms piled up a few penalties and Miller then went for 10 mins misconduct. Peterborough then equalised at 39.42 by Rempel receiving a pass from Gough.
At 2-2, both teams had to work hard to gain the advantage with the Scimitars out-shooting Peterborough but unable to finish. The game looked as though it would go to overtime to break the deadlock but it was the Scimitars, through Robert Dowd, who finished it off in regulation time as he broke away and backhanded the puck in at 59.19. After a time out and pulling their netminder the Phantoms threw everything at the net in the remaining 1.21 seconds but to no avail and the Scimitars claimed the 2 points, with James Goodman earning himself the MOM award.
Game Details
Period Scores
Sheffield 1/1/1 = 3
Peterboro' 0/2/0 = 2
Penalty Mins
Sheffield 4/ 12/ 0 = 16
Peterboro' 18/ 26 /2 = 46
SOG
Jones 7/11/ 9 = 27/2
Wall 14/ 13 /17 = 44/3
Scoring Details
Sheffield: Moberg, Shudra & Dowd 1+1, Morgan 0+2, Wallace 0+1.
MOM. Goodman
Peterboro': Gough 1+1, Rempel 1+0. MOM: Gough
Referee: D. Goodwin. Linesmen: C. Herrington & J. Liptrott
Attendance: 480
